Q: Is 112,202,155 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 112,202,155 is a composite number.

Why is 112,202,155 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 112,202,155 can be evenly divided by 1 5 13 65 131 655 1,703 8,515 13,177 65,885 171,301 856,505 1,726,187 8,630,935 22,440,431 and 112,202,155, with no remainder.

Since 112,202,155 cannot be divided by just 1 and 112,202,155, it is a composite number.
